A Spanish Style Sauteed mushroom dish made with a variety of edible mushrooms.
Ingredients
3 Tbsp of grapeseed oil
½ - 1lb fresh mushrooms (brushed clean, stems trimmed (or not) and if they are large coarsely sliced - if you wash them pat them dry with a paper towel)
4-5 cloves garlic peeled and sliced thin
2 large scallions peeled and sliced thin
2 tsp lemon juice
2 Tbsp Spanish Sherry (or regular cooking sherry if not available)
¼ cup chicken broth or vegetable broth (if vegetarian)
½ tsp Spanish paprika or regular paprika if you can't find any
¼ tsp crushed red pepper flakes
salt and pepper to taste
1 Tbsp fresh Italian parsley minced
Instructions
Heat the oil in a skillet until it is very hot. Sear the mushrooms for 2 minutes.
Add the scallions and garlic and saute for another 1-2 minutes.
Lower the heat and stir in the lemon juice, sherry, broth, paprika,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per.
Simmer a minute or two.
Place in a serving dish. Sprinkle with parsley and serve.
